The lunchbox and Ppeoggeuri I ate today

1) I served in the Air Force, so I never had the opportunity to try [Ppeoggeuri].

I saw a scene in a military drama where they ate [Ppeoggeuri] deliciously, so I wanted to try it and gave it a try.

2) As reviewed beforehand, without opening the ramen packet, carefully break the ramen into four equal parts to prevent the packet from bursting.

Carefully open the packet again, rearrange the divided ramen to make it easier to add water, add the [dried vegetable flakes] and [ramen seasoning packet], and then fill with water.

3) Secure the ramen packet with chopsticks like this.

4) I ate a lunchbox while the ramen was cooking.

I ate a 7-Eleven convenience store lunchbox for the first time.

5) I took a bite and it tasted better than I expected.

It tastes better than Shin Ramyun cup noodles.

How should I put it? It tastes like putting a packet of ramen in a ceramic bowl, adding water, and microwaving it.

It tastes good even in civilian life, but it must have tasted truly amazing in the military.

The downside is that it is inconvenient to drink the broth.
